Characterization of Materials
Welcome
to the home of Characterization of Materials. This online reference
provides comprehensive up-to-date coverage of materials characterization
techniques including computational and theoretical methods as
well as crystallography, mechanical testing, thermal analysis,
optical imaging and spectroscopy, and more.
This reference work is specifically designed to offer not only a fundamental understanding of each major technique, but to lead you to the most appropriate technique given the particular material and property you need to measure.
Characterization of Materials is a collection of characterization methods that are widely applicable in the wide and diverse field of materials research for materials scientists, engineers, and educators.
Methods Covered Include:
- General Vacuum Techniques
- X-Ray Powder Diffraction
- High Strain Rate Testing
- Deep Level Transient Spectroscopy
- Cyclic Voltammetry
- Extended X-Ray Absorption Fine Structure
- Low Energy Electron Diffraction
- Thermogravimetric Analysis
- Magnetometry
- Transmission Electron Microscopy
- Ultraviolet Photoelectron Spectroscopy
